CWE-532: Insertion of Sensitive Information into Log Files vulnerability exists that could cause the disclosure of FTP server credentials when the FTP server is deployed, and the device is placed in debug mode by an administrative user and the debug files are exported from the device.

This vulnerability allows FTP server credentials to be written to debug log files when debug mode is enabled on a device with a deployed FTP server. When an administrative user places the device in debug mode and exports the debug files, the credentials stored for the FTP server are disclosed in the logs due to insufficient sanitization of sensitive information in debug output.

MitigationAvoid enabling debug mode on devices with deployed FTP servers. If debugging is required, ensure debug files are protected with access controls and not exported unless absolutely necessary. Consider implementing credential masking in all debug logging paths.

Work through these to decide whether this CVE applies to you.

  1. Identify if FTP server is deployed
    Check device configuration for FTP server settings, or look for FTP service listening on port 21
    Affected if FTP server is configured and running on the device
  2. Verify if debug mode is enabled
    Check device administrative interface or configuration files for debug/logging mode settings
    Affected if Debug mode is currently enabled on the device
  3. Locate debug log files
    Search standard debug log directories on the device for recently modified log files, especially those generated after debug mode was activated
    Affected if Debug log files exist and were created during debug mode sessions
  4. Search debug logs for FTP credentials
    Grep or search debug log files for strings matching FTP username, password, or authentication fields (e.g., patterns like 'ftp', 'pass', credentials in plain text)
    Affected if Debug logs contain FTP server credentials in plain text
  5. Check for exported debug files
    Review any exported or downloaded debug bundles from the device
    Affected if Debug files were exported externally while FTP server credentials were configured

The environment is affected if FTP server credentials can be found in debug log files or exported debug bundles, which occurs when debug mode is enabled on a device with a deployed FTP server.
